CBD Healthcare Company (CBDHCC) has become the First-Ever Personal Care Product to have earned certification to NSF Guideline 527 and NSF Certified for Sport® for its Broad-Spectrum CBD Balancing Massage and Body Oil.

  • NSF Certified for Sport® certifies dietary supplements, functional foods, cosmetics and personal care products to be free from substances banned by major sporting organizations.
  • Products Certified for Sport® must also be certified to either NSF/ANSI 173, NSF 229 or NSF 527 to ensure their contents match their claims.

Sports company PUMA reduced its greenhouse gas emissions by 24% in 2023 compared to 2022, despite a strong sales growth.

  • Compared with the 2017 baseline, this means an absolute greenhouse gas emission reduction of 29%.

    With an 85% reduction of own emissions and a 65% reduction of supply chain emissions relative to sales, PUMA achieved its first science-based greenhouse gas reduction target in 2023, seven years ahead of the target year 2030.
